How they compare

New Zealand currently reports 175,467 1000 USD against 149,119 1000 USD in Saudi Arabia, a difference of 26,348 1000 USD.

That makes New Zealand's figure about 1.2 times Saudi Arabia's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 33 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Saudi Arabia ahead.

New Zealand ranks 44th and Saudi Arabia ranks 47th of 204 countries.

New Zealand has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ade New Zealand Saudi Arabia Difference Ahead
1990s 81,674 1000 USD 17,802 1000 USD 63,872 1000 USD New Zealand
2000s 185,673 1000 USD 51,423 1000 USD 134,251 1000 USD New Zealand
2010s 240,587 1000 USD 168,021 1000 USD 72,566 1000 USD New Zealand
2020s 202,314 1000 USD 198,374 1000 USD 3,940 1000 USD New Zealand

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
